Time is nearing to the 1st anniversary of release of the first ever version of Granular. For everyone's information, Granular first version, 0.12, was released publicly on 31st December, 2006. Let come 31st Dec, 2007, and Granular would be 1 year old.

And that's the reason of starting this contest. All you have to do is design and submit (here) a standard size banner image for the 1st birthday of Granular.
